Output 7591a76572c8f4f30bc0a22df04e40ba1fcf089dac5d053c62a36134d4a73b9c:5

value
10965
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 586290fc912713a460041f1f7a648a94ed79167e7f28b88dcd44e614a43005a9
address
bc1ptp3fply3yuf6gcqyru0h5ey2jnkhj9n70u5t3rwdgnnpffpsqk5sur4k3t
transaction
7591a76572c8f4f30bc0a22df04e40ba1fcf089dac5d053c62a36134d4a73b9c
confirmations
69609
spent
true